From d5768910039bb0e4d915fd9cd16cd9a46d1a4e11 Mon Sep 17 00:00:00 2001 From: Ben Pai Date: Thu, 11 Jun 2020 16:40:40 +0800 Subject: meta-ibm: mihawk: Add 250 soc thermal sensor Mihawk can use up to eight 250-soc. Tested: The user can see the temperature when using 250-soc. (From meta-ibm rev: 74b7557b08ed2582861cd7da390d84371ec2ff86) Change-Id: I17b0d969d0902f6470287c6164f542ad84412f7d Signed-off-by: Ben Pai Signed-off-by: Andrew Geissler --- meta-ibm/recipes-kernel/linux/linux-aspeed/mihawk.cfg | 1 + .../ap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@0/tmp431@4c.conf | 5 +++++ .../ap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@1/tmp431@4c.conf | 5 +++++ .../ap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@0/tmp431@4c.conf | 5 +++++ .../ap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@1/tmp431@4c.conf | 5 +++++ .../ap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@0/tmp431@4c.conf | 5 +++++ .../ap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@1/tmp431@4c.conf | 5 +++++ .../ap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@0/tmp431@4c.conf | 5 +++++ .../ap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@1/tmp431@4c.conf | 5 +++++ meta-ibm/recipes-phosphor/sensors/phosphor-hwmon_%.bbappend | 8 ++++++++ 10 files changed, 49 insertions(+) create mode 100644 me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@0/tmp431@4c.conf create mode 100644 me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@1/tmp431@4c.conf create mode 100644 me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@0/tmp431@4c.conf create mode 100644 me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@1/tmp431@4c.conf create mode 100644 me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@0/tmp431@4c.conf create mode 100644 me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@1/tmp431@4c.conf create mode 100644 me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@0/tmp431@4c.conf create mode 100644 me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@1/tmp431@4c.conf diff --git a/meta-ibm/recipes-kernel/linux/linux-aspeed/mihawk.cfg b/meta-ibm/recipes-kernel/linux/linux-aspeed/mihawk.cfg index 63c39a9d4..e81c14a5f 100644 --- a/meta-ibm/recipes-kernel/linux/linux-aspeed/mihawk.cfg +++ b/meta-ibm/recipes-kernel/linux/linux-aspeed/mihawk.cfg @@ -1,5 +1,6 @@ CONFIG_HWMON=y CONFIG_SENSORS_IIO_HWMON=y +CONFIG_SENSORS_TMP401=y CONFIG_SENSORS_TMP421=y CONFIG_SENSORS_MAX31785=y CONFIG_SENSORS_UCD9000=y di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@0/tmp431@4c.conf b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@0/tmp431@4c.conf new file mode 100644 index 000000000..1cad7deb8 --- /dev/null +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@0/tmp431@4c.conf @@ -0,0 +1,5 @@ +LABEL_temp2 = "250_soc2" +WARNHI_temp2 = "95000" +WARNLO_temp2 = "0" +CRITHI_temp2 = "100000" +CRITLO_temp2 = "0" di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@1/tmp431@4c.conf b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@1/tmp431@4c.conf new file mode 100644 index 000000000..cd28bd793 --- /dev/null +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@70/i2c@1/tmp431@4c.conf @@ -0,0 +1,5 @@ +LABEL_temp2 = "250_soc3" +WARNHI_temp2 = "95000" +WARNLO_temp2 = "0" +CRITHI_temp2 = "100000" +CRITLO_temp2 = "0" di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@0/tmp431@4c.conf b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@0/tmp431@4c.conf new file mode 100644 index 000000000..33463645b --- /dev/null +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@0/tmp431@4c.conf @@ -0,0 +1,5 @@ +LABEL_temp2 = "250_soc0" +WARNHI_temp2 = "95000" +WARNLO_temp2 = "0" +CRITHI_temp2 = "100000" +CRITLO_temp2 = "0" di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@1/tmp431@4c.conf b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@1/tmp431@4c.conf new file mode 100644 index 000000000..60dafc672 --- /dev/null +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@380/pca9545@71/i2c@1/tmp431@4c.conf @@ -0,0 +1,5 @@ +LABEL_temp2 = "250_soc1" +WARNHI_temp2 = "95000" +WARNLO_temp2 = "0" +CRITHI_temp2 = "100000" +CRITLO_temp2 = "0" di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@0/tmp431@4c.conf b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@0/tmp431@4c.conf new file mode 100644 index 000000000..d8f95b047 --- /dev/null +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@0/tmp431@4c.conf @@ -0,0 +1,5 @@ +LABEL_temp2 = "250_soc6" +WARNHI_temp2 = "95000" +WARNLO_temp2 = "0" +CRITHI_temp2 = "100000" +CRITLO_temp2 = "0" di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@1/tmp431@4c.conf b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@1/tmp431@4c.conf new file mode 100644 index 000000000..1b075b30f --- /dev/null +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@1/tmp431@4c.conf @@ -0,0 +1,5 @@ +LABEL_temp2 = "250_soc7" +WARNHI_temp2 = "95000" +WARNLO_temp2 = "0" +CRITHI_temp2 = "100000" +CRITLO_temp2 = "0" di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@0/tmp431@4c.conf b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@0/tmp431@4c.conf new file mode 100644 index 000000000..a66df302f --- /dev/null +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@0/tmp431@4c.conf @@ -0,0 +1,5 @@ +LABEL_temp2 = "250_soc5" +WARNHI_temp2 = "95000" +WARNLO_temp2 = "0" +CRITHI_temp2 = "100000" +CRITLO_temp2 = "0" di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@1/tmp431@4c.conf b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@1/tmp431@4c.conf new file mode 100644 index 000000000..6d3f24a5e --- /dev/null +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on/mihawk/obmc/hwmon/ahb/apb/b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@1/tmp431@4c.conf @@ -0,0 +1,5 @@ +LABEL_temp2 = "250_soc4" +WARNHI_temp2 = "95000" +WARNLO_temp2 = "0" +CRITHI_temp2 = "100000" +CRITLO_temp2 = "0" diff --git a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on_%.bbappend b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on_%.bbappend index 36029dd72..e2e8402c4 100644 --- a/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on_%.bbappend +++ b/meta-ibm/recipes-phosphor/sensors/phosphor-hwmon_%.bbappend @@ -45,6 +45,14 @@ CHIPS_mihawk = " \ bus@1e78a000/i2c-bus@140/ir35221@72 \ bus@1e78a000/i2c-bus@180/ir35221@70 \ bus@1e78a000/i2c-bus@180/ir35221@72 \ + bus@1e78a000/i2c-bus@380/pca9545@70/i2c@0/tmp431@4c \ + bus@1e78a000/i2c-bus@380/pca9545@70/i2c@1/tmp431@4c \ + bus@1e78a000/i2c-bus@380/pca9545@71/i2c@0/tmp431@4c \ + bus@1e78a000/i2c-bus@380/pca9545@71/i2c@1/tmp431@4c \ + b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@0/tmp431@4c \ + bus@1e78a000/i2c-bus@3c0/pca9545@70/i2c@1/tmp431@4c \ + b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@0/tmp431@4c \ + bus@1e78a000/i2c-bus@3c0/pca9545@71/i2c@1/tmp431@4c \ bus@1e78a000/i2c-bus@400/tmp275@48 \ bus@1e78a000/i2c-bus@400/tmp275@49 \ pwm-tacho-controller@1e786000 \ -- cgit v1.2.3